Output d3eafc382b7121baa3ca61b9b31793f737b9204c4a84a55a234312732207f066:1

value
187394
script pubkey
OP_0 OP_PUSHBYTES_20 505f93a78ec855cb3774bd1895a84e4e9edf5ea6
address
bc1q2p0e8fuwep2ukdm5h5vft2zwf60d7h4x8xgqww
transaction
d3eafc382b7121baa3ca61b9b31793f737b9204c4a84a55a234312732207f066
spent
true